Key Risk Control Tools to Look for in a Forex Broker
1. Stop-Loss Orders
A stop-loss order is one of the most basic and essential risk control tools for traders. It automatically closes your position once the market price hits a predefined level, helping you limit your losses if the market moves against you.
- Guaranteed Stop-Loss Orders (GSLO): Some brokers offer guaranteed stop-loss orders, ensuring your trade is closed at the stop price, even during high volatility or gaps in the market.
- Trailing Stops: Trailing stop orders allow your stop-loss to move in your favour as the market price improves, locking in profits while still protecting your position.

2. Negative Balance Protection
Negative balance protection ensures that your account balance will never go below zero, even if the market moves dramatically against your position. This is particularly important for traders using high leverage, as unexpected market movements can lead to substantial losses.
- Leverage Restrictions: Brokers offering negative balance protection often apply leverage limits to reduce the risk of traders owing more than their account balance in case of major market fluctuations.

3. Leverage Control
Leverage is a double-edged sword in forex trading: while it allows you to control larger positions with less capital, it also amplifies the risk of large losses. The best brokers provide leverage control tools that allow traders to set their preferred level of leverage to suit their risk tolerance.
- Adjustable Leverage: The ability to adjust your leverage ensures that you can tailor your risk management strategy based on your trading style and experience level.
- Leverage Limits for Different Regions: Some brokers restrict leverage based on regulatory requirements in different regions, such as the European Union (which limits leverage to 30:1) or the United States (where the limit is 50:1 for forex trading).

4. Risk Management Alerts and Notifications
Effective risk management is not only about tools within the platform; it’s also about being aware of market movements that could impact your trades. Brokers that offer risk management alerts can help you stay on top of your positions and make adjustments as needed.
- Price Alerts: Brokers that offer price alerts notify you when a market reaches a predefined level, allowing you to take action before the market moves too far against you.
- Margin Calls and Alerts: Many brokers send margin call alerts to warn you when your equity is approaching the margin level required to maintain your open positions.

5. Margin Management Tools
Margin management is an essential aspect of risk control. By managing your margin usage, you can prevent excessive exposure and avoid margin calls. The best brokers offer tools that allow traders to monitor and control their margin usage.
- Margin Level Indicators: Brokers provide margin level indicators that show how much of your account’s balance is being used to maintain your open positions. This helps you avoid over-leveraging and manage your margin requirements more effectively.
- Auto-Close Feature: Some brokers offer auto-close features that automatically close positions once a trader’s margin level falls below a certain threshold, preventing the account from falling into a negative balance.

6. Position Sizing Tools
Position sizing is a critical aspect of risk management. The best forex brokers offer position sizing calculators and tools that help traders determine the appropriate trade size based on their account size and risk tolerance.
- Risk Percentage Calculator: This tool helps traders calculate the ideal position size based on the percentage of their account balance they are willing to risk per trade.
- Trade Size Calculator: Some brokers provide trade size calculators that factor in stop-loss levels, account balance, and desired risk percentage to suggest the optimal trade size for each position.

7. Trading Automation Features
Automated trading can be a powerful tool for managing risk, as it removes the emotional element from trading decisions. Many brokers offer automated trading features that allow traders to use expert advisors (EAs) or create automated strategies to control risk.
- Expert Advisors (EAs): EAs allow traders to set predefined risk management rules, such as automatic stop-loss, take-profit, or trailing stops, and execute trades according to these rules without manual intervention.
- Algorithmic Trading: Brokers that support algorithmic trading allow traders to create custom trading strategies and risk management rules that are automatically executed by the platform.
